Cannoli Pie

Cannoli Pie: 7 Irresistibly Creamy Reasons to Indulge

  • Author: Lisa
  • Prep Time: 20 minutes
  • Cook Time: 10 minutes
  • Total Time: 2 hours 30 minutes
  • Yield: 8 servings 1x
  • Category: Dessert
  • Method: Baking
  • Cuisine: Italian
  • Diet: Vegetarian

Description

A delicious twist on traditional cannoli, this Cannoli Pie features a creamy filling and a flaky crust.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 pre-made pie crust
  • 15 oz ricotta cheese
  • 1 cup powdered sugar
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ract
  • 1/2 cup mini chocolate chips
  • 1/4 cup chopped pistachios
  • 1/2 cup heavy cream

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C).
  2. Fit the pie crust into a pie dish and bake for 10 minutes.
  3. In a bowl, mix ricotta cheese, powdered sugar, and vanilla extract until smooth.
  4. Fold in chocolate chips and pistachios.
  5. In another bowl, whip the heavy cream until stiff peaks form.
  6. Gently fold the whipped cream into the ricotta mixture.
  7. Pour the filling into the cooled pie crust.
  8. Chill in the refrigerator for at least 2 hours before serving.

Notes

  • For best flavor, use whole milk ricotta.
  • You can substitute chocolate chips with dried fruit.
  • Top with extra chocolate chips or nuts if desired.
